On 07/12/2018 08:12 AM, Markus Armbruster wrote:
> The functions to receive messages are called qtest_qmp_receive() and
> qmp_receive(), qmp_fd_receive().  The ones to send messages are called
> qtest_async_qmp(), qtest_async_qmpv(), qmp_async(), qmp_fd_send(),
> qmp_fd_sendv().  Inconsistent.  Rename the *_async* ones to
> qmp_send(), qtest_qmp_send(), qtest_qmp_vsend().  Rename
> qmp_fd_sendv() to qmp_fd_vsend().
